Common Signs of Hip Dysplasia

While many dogs may initially show no signs, frequent signs of hip dysplasia often become noticeable as they mature. Affected dogs may show a significant drop in activity levels, causing disinclination toward play or exercise. Owners might observe a characteristic "bunny hop" gait, where the dog moves both hind legs simultaneously rather than alternating them. Lameness or stiffness, particularly after periods of rest, can also be indicative of the condition.

Additionally, dogs may have difficulty getting up from a lying position or exhibit signs of discomfort when climbing stairs or jumping. Weight gain can happen due to decreased mobility, further worsening joint issues. Behavioral changes, such as irritability or withdrawal, may also occur as dogs endure pain. Recognizing these symptoms early can be vital for timely intervention and management of hip dysplasia, ultimately improving the dog's quality of life.

What Varieties Face Greater Risk for Hip Dysplasia?

Specific dog breeds are prone to hip dysplasia on account of genetic factors and their physical structure. Large and giant breeds, such as German Shepherds, Golden Retrievers, Rottweilers, and St. Bernards, are particularly at risk. These dogs often possess a mix of weight and skeletal conformation that places additional stress on their joints.

Mid-sized breeds such as Bulldogs and Boxers also experience greater risk, as their unusual body structures can cause hip joint malformation. Furthermore, certain small breeds, including Dachshunds and Cocker Spaniels, may suffer from hip dysplasia, though less often than bigger breeds.

Understanding breed predisposition is critical for dog owners and breeders alike, as it emphasizes the importance of conscientious breeding methods and early detection. Regular veterinary check-ups can help identify potential issues before they progress, maintaining a healthier life for these vulnerable dog populations.

How Genetics and Environment Affect Hip Dysplasia

Understanding the interplay between hereditary factors and surroundings is essential in addressing hip dysplasia in dogs. The condition is significantly influenced by hereditary factors, with certain breeds predisposed to developing hip dysplasia due to inherited traits. DNA alterations affecting joint formation can lead to improper development, increasing the likelihood of hip dysplasia.

Environmental elements also have a critical role. Obesity, for example, places extra stress on a dog's hips, exacerbating the likelihood of dysplasia. In addition, inadequate nutrition during growth phases can result in bone irregularities. Overexertion during early developmental stages, particularly in large breeds, can additionally contribute to joint problems.

In the end, a mix of genetics and surroundings creates a layered risk profile for hip dysplasia. Comprehending these factors allows pet owners and breeders to make well-informed choices, potentially mitigating the prevalence of this challenging condition in dogs.

Possible Surgical Methods Options

Surgical intervention offers a variety of options for dogs affected by hip dysplasia, designed to reducing pain and enhancing mobility. The most frequent procedures include femoral head ostectomy (FHO) and total hip replacement (THR). FHO entails extracting the femoral head, enabling the body to form a false joint, which can decrease pain. Total hip replacement, on the other hand, replaces the entire hip joint with a prosthetic, leading to better function and decreased discomfort. Another option is the triple pelvic osteotomy (TPO), which realigns the hip socket to more effectively support the femur. The selection of procedure relies on the dog's age, severity of dysplasia, and overall health, requiring careful consideration by veterinary professionals to ensure optimal outcomes.

Medicine and Pain Reduction

Managing hip dysplasia effectively in dogs typically involves a blend of medications and pain relief strategies aimed at enhancing daily comfort. NSAIDs are commonly used to control swelling and relieve discomfort, which allows for enhanced mobility. Veterinarians may sometimes recommend glucosamine and chondroitin supplements to maintain joint health and function. Corticocopyrights might also be administered for their anti-inflammatory properties, although they carry potential side effects if used long-term. Pain management may also require opioids for more severe discomfort. Continuous monitoring and adjustments to medication types and dosages are necessary, as individual responses can vary significantly among dogs, providing ideal care and comfort throughout the treatment process.

Lifestyle and Recovery Strategies

Lifestyle and rehabilitation strategies play an essential role in managing hip dysplasia in dogs. Regular, controlled exercise helps maintain muscle strength and joint flexibility, reducing discomfort. Low-impact activities, such as swimming and walking on soft surfaces, are particularly beneficial. Weight management is vital; maintaining a healthy body condition can alleviate stress on the hips. Additionally, physical therapy techniques, including massage and stretching, can enhance mobility and improve overall quality of life. Joint supplements, like glucosamine and omega-3 fatty acids, may also support joint health. Providing a comfortable resting area, using orthopedic beds, and avoiding excessive jumping or stair climbing further contribute to a dog's well-being. Together, these strategies foster a more active, pain-free lifestyle for dogs dealing with hip dysplasia.

Can a Blood Test Detect Hip Dysplasia?

Hip dysplasia is not diagnosable through a blood test. Assessment usually requires hands-on helpful tips exams, health history, and imaging methods like X-rays to gauge joint structure and function, offering a thorough grasp of the condition.

Can Hip Dysplasia Produce Aching in Dogs?

Hip dysplasia can be painful for dogs, as it leads to joint instability and joint inflammation. Symptoms often include limping, trouble getting up, and aversion to exercise, affecting their overall quality of life.

What Strategies Can Help Prevent Hip Dysplasia in My Puppy?

To reduce the likelihood of hip dysplasia in a puppy, maintain a healthy weight, offer well-balanced meals, ensure appropriate exercise, and limit high-impact activities and vigorous play—effective strategies that promote proper joint development and reduce risk.

Do Complementary Therapies Exist for Hip Dysplasia?

Alternative methods for hip dysplasia include acupuncture, physical therapy, and chiropractic adjustments. Additionally, supplements like glucosamine and omega-3 fatty acids may help minimize pain and strengthen mobility, supporting overall joint health in affected dogs.

What Is the Duration of life of a Dog With Hip Dysplasia?

Dogs with hip dysplasia can live a normal lifespan, generally 10 to 15 years, depending on factors including extent, appropriate care, and general condition. Effective care through good diet, regular exercise, and professional veterinary guidance significantly determines life expectancy.
